asked 02/04/19I have the length and Width of a room but I have no height and volume. Can I figure out the height without volume.
Inactive Tutor answered 02/04/19
Without a third piece of information, you can't. While knowing the height directly would be easiest, other possibilities would include the length of a diagonal from a given upper corner to a given lower one.
